Car Speaker Sounds Scratchy . Loose connections are one of the most common causes for speakers to start crackling. Loose connections usually cause crackling sounds in your speakers. First, inspect the wires that connect the amplifier or radio to prevent crackling in your car speakers. If your car speaker is crackling, there are a few possible causes and fixes. There are multiple reasons why your car speakers may have been producing that irritating crackling sound. Car speaker crackling can be caused by a variety of issues, including wiring issues, blown speakers, dirty or corroded connections, power issues, and compatibility. The most obvious sign that your car speakers are crackling is a popping or static noise coming from the speakers. Once you start hearing unusual sounds from your car speakers, such as the annoying crackling noise, check the wire connections first and foremost. The most common cause is electric or magnetic interference, which can be fixed by shielding the wires to the car speakers.
